Rolex Gold Men's Watch Price: A Range of Splendor

The price of a men's gold Rolex watch spans a considerable range, influenced by numerous variables. The starting point for a new gold Rolex is significantly higher than most other luxury watch brands, reflecting the brand's prestige and the quality of materials and manufacturing. You can expect to pay tens of thousands of dollars, easily reaching into the six-figure range for highly sought-after models or those with intricate complications.

Several key factors determine the final price:

* Metal: The karat of gold significantly impacts the price. 18k gold is the most common in Rolex watches, offering a balance of durability and rich color. While 18k yellow gold is the most prevalent, you'll also find 18k white gold (often with a rhodium plating) and 18k Everose gold (Rolex's proprietary pink gold alloy). The higher the karat, the higher the gold content and, consequently, the price. Solid gold refers to watches where the case and bracelet are made entirely of gold, further increasing the cost.

* Model: Different Rolex models carry different price tags. The iconic Oyster Perpetual, while available in gold, represents a more accessible entry point compared to the flagship Day-Date or the highly sought-after Submariner. The complexity of the movement also plays a role; watches with complications like chronographs or annual calendars command higher prices.

* Condition: The condition of the watch dramatically affects its value. A pristine, unworn, and box-and-papers (including the original box and warranty papers) Rolex will fetch a significantly higher price than a pre-owned watch with scratches or signs of wear. This is particularly true for vintage models, where condition is paramount.

* Demand: The popularity of specific models fluctuates over time, impacting their resale value and new prices. Limited-edition releases or discontinued models often command premium prices due to scarcity. Certain dial colors or variations can also increase desirability and therefore the cost.

* Retailer: Purchasing from an authorized Rolex retailer will typically result in a higher price than buying from a reputable pre-owned watch dealer or auction house. However, buying from an authorized dealer offers the assurance of authenticity and warranty.

Used Men's Gold Rolex Watches: A Smart Alternative

The pre-owned market offers a compelling alternative to buying new. Used men's gold Rolex watches can represent significant savings, often 30-50% less than their original retail price, depending on condition and demand. However, due diligence is crucial. Ensure you purchase from a reputable dealer with a strong track record and verification process to avoid counterfeit watches. Thorough inspection of the watch's authenticity is essential, and ideally, a professional appraisal can confirm its genuineness and condition.
